Mischief Management Postpones 2020 Events, Announces Dates For 2021

mischief management logo

The Press Release:
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, Mischief Management has secured new dates for all its 2020 events — Con of Thrones, LeakyCon Orlando, PodcastCon, and LeakyCon Denver — while keeping
the events in the same host cities as previously announced. Mischief looks forward to celebrating together with all of our attendees and guests in a safe and exciting way in 2021.

“Normally, we would be moving our events to different cities each year. Instead, we have worked with local venues to assure the events we promised can still take place,” says Melissa Anelli, CEO of Mischief Management. “With more time to properly develop these events we are looking forward to an incredible 2021. Our entire community has been expressing such kindness and patience during this unprecedented time, and we thank them and can’t wait to see them again.”

Each event’s rescheduled dates are as follows:
* Con of Thrones will now take place August 6-8, 2021 , at the Hyatt Regency Orlando. For more information, please visit the link at the close.
* LeakyCon Orlando will now take place June 25-27, 2021 , at the Orange County Convention Center in Orlando, FL. For more information, please the link at the close.
* PodcastCon will now take place August 20-22, 2021 , at the McCormick Place Convention Center in Chicago, IL. For more information, please visit the link at the close.
* LeakyCon Denver will now take place October 29-31, 2021 , at the Crowne Plaza Denver Airport Convention Center in Denver, CO. For more information, please visit the link at the close.

Tickets purchased for 2020 events will be automatically honored for 2021 events. Ticket holders also have the option of transferring to a corresponding 2022 event. Those who retain their tickets will receive additional benefits and discounts throughout the coming year. We are working to ensure that any currently announced guests will be in attendance at the new event dates. In
the event that a guest is unable to attend, attendees who have purchased add-on experiences with the guests will be contacted directly with more information regarding refunds for those add-ons. Requests for refunds will be accepted through Friday, June 19, 2020.

About Mischief Management:
Mischief Management produces fan conventions focusing on community, content, and creativity. Since 2009, it has served tens of thousands of fans, providing a fun, vibrant, and safe space to enjoy the things they love. Mischief Management’s event lineup includes Con of Thrones (for fans of Game of Thrones and the writings of George R.R. Martin), BroadwayCon (for fans of theatre and Broadway), LeakyCon (for fans of Harry Potter ), and PodcastCon (for podcast fans and creators).
